What Is the Air Quality Index?

The air quality index (AQI) is a standardized system used to measure and report the level of air pollution in a specific area. It translates complex data about various pollutants into a single, easy-to-understand value. The AQI allows people to know how polluted the air is and how it might affect their health.

The AQI typically considers pollutants such as particulate matter (PM2.5 and PM10), nitrogen dioxide (NO2), sulfur dioxide (SO2), carbon monoxide (CO), and ozone (O3). Each pollutant contributes to the overall index, which is usually categorized into ranges like Good, Moderate, Unhealthy, and Hazardous.

Air Quality Situation in Faisalabad

Faisalabad, often referred to as the Manchester of Pakistan due to its textile industry, experiences significant industrial pollution. The city’s AQI is influenced by a combination of factors including industrial emissions, traffic congestion, dust from construction, and seasonal agricultural activities such as crop burning.

Studies and local monitoring reports indicate that Faisalabad frequently experiences AQI levels that fall into the Unhealthy or Very Unhealthy categories, particularly during winter months when temperature inversions trap pollutants near the ground.

Main Sources of Pollution

Understanding the sources of air pollution in Faisalabad helps explain fluctuations in the AQI

  • Textile and industrial emissions releasing particulate matter and chemicals
  • Vehicular emissions including carbon monoxide and nitrogen oxides
  • Construction dust and urban development activities
  • Burning of crop residue in surrounding agricultural areas

These factors combined contribute to a challenging air quality environment that affects residents daily.

Seasonal Variations in AQI

Air quality in Faisalabad fluctuates throughout the year. Winter often brings higher AQI levels due to temperature inversions and increased burning of biomass. Conversely, monsoon and post-monsoon seasons may temporarily improve air quality as rain helps clear particulate matter from the atmosphere.

Factors Affecting Seasonal AQI

  • Weather conditions such as wind and temperature inversions
  • Industrial production cycles
  • Agricultural burning practices
  • Urban construction and traffic patterns
